  2. Drones for 3D Indoor Exploration-Cultural Relics Protection and Indoor Survey

    In recent years, interest in using drones for indoor applications has grown significantly. Traditionally, most drone applications have focused on outdoor environments such as forests, fields, and construction sites. However, advancements in indoor S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ping) and 3D mapping have sparked interest in exploring the potential of drones for indoor operations.

    Drones excel in indoor environments due to their ability to cover large areas faster than wheeled robots. By leveraging aerial mobility, drones can traverse different heights within buildings, creating accurate maps of various structures.
